Taiwan expresses concern on Beijing's aggressive and destabilizing actions near the Diaoyutai Islands

| @indiablooms | Feb 21, 2021, at 04:56 am

Taipei: Taiwan has expressed concern over Beijing’s aggressive and destabilizing actions near the Diaoyutai Islands.

On Monday and Tuesday, four Chinese coast guard ships sailed near the Diaoyutai Islands, one of which was equipped with a cannon, reports Taipei Times.

Two of the ships sailed away on Tuesday morning, including an armed vessel, while the others attempted to approach a Japanese fishing boat, the Japan Coast Guard said, reports the news portal.

The uninhabited islands located on the East China Sea, are claimed by Taipei, Beijing and Tokyo.

It was the first armed incursion since China’s enactment on Feb. 1 of a new Coast Guard Law, which authorizes its coast guard to inspect and use weapons on foreign vessels in waters claimed by Beijing, Taipei Times.
